Site planner - Multinational Biopharma company

We are looking for a highly motivated individual to join our client as a Site Planner. Our client is a biopharmaceutical company engaged in the development of innovative cancer immunotherapies.

Location: Amsterdam area

Contract: 6 months

Start date: ASAP

As Site Planner you'll be joining the Site Planning & Material Management department, in which employees of all backgrounds and experiences are respected, and where working together focused on saving lives, by finding the cure for cancer, is a daily activity.
Together with the Site Planning team you will be responsible for scheduling and monitoring the daily progress of Patient orders. You will work closely with stakeholders from different departments like Manufacturing, Quality, Supply Chain and Engineering & Facility.
You will provide and maintain detailed overall site scheduling production plans for all clinical and commercial products at the facility in the Netherlands to assure no gaps or delays in processing, release, and shipments.



Your respon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
* Minimize variability and align logistics, demand planning and sourcing to ensure minimum financial impact and uninterrupted QC and manufacturing operations
* Support patient driven demand of apheresis shipments and final frozen product LN2 shipments collaboratively across the site to ensure that shipment requests are timely coordinated for both clinical and commercial products
* Be part of / facilitate the daily interdepartmental meetings to assure that the schedule will be met and resources are available. Be part of and interact with project teams to assess the impact of project activities on the daily operational schedule. Interact with project team and task managers to define scope of work to develop and update detailed schedules, cost information and identification of variances from original plan. Create and maintain planning and logistics metrics to enable process improvements
* Support changes in BOM, demand and supply, perform planning assessment as needed; support raw material inventory and supply control as required
* Coordinate activities required to support the manufacture, packaging, labeling, shipping, and distribution of clinical and commercial materials
* Develop and implement logistics and planning tools through MS Project, spreadsheet and relational databases for supply chain, procurement and operations team

Requirements:
* Bachelor degree in Life Sciences, project management or related business administration is required with a certification in logistics or planning preferred
* In depth knowledge of planning requirements and production scheduling
* At least 6 years of experience in pharmaceutical industry with 3 years of relevant production planning - clinical and commercial supply experience at a pharmaceutical, CRO or biotech company in a planning and supply chain management role preferred
* Experience working closely with Manufacturing, Project Management, functional team leaders, clinical teams and contract manufacturing partners
* Excellent MS Office and MS Project skills
* Additional specific qualifications in the area of supplies demand and logistics/ or planning management including and APICs, CPIM, and related processional certifications preferred
* Critical attention to detail is necessary for this role
* Self-motivated and willing to accept temporary responsibilities outside of initial job description
* Excellent interpersonal, verbal and written communication skills are essential in this collaborative work environment
* Comfortable in a fast-paced and dynamic environment with minimal direction and able to adjust workload based upon changing priorities
* Able to work after hours, weekends, and on call as needed
